+## Installation
+
+To install the Python client library using pip:
+
+ pip install nexmo
+
+To upgrade your installed client library using pip:
+
+ pip install nexmo --upgrade
+
+Alternatively, you can clone the repository via the command line:
+
+ git clone git@github.com:Nexmo/nexmo-python.git
+
+or by opening it on GitHub desktop.
+
+## Usage
+
+Begin by importing the `nexmo` module:
+
+```python
+import nexmo
+```
+
+Then construct a client object with your key and secret:
+
+```python
+client = nexmo.Client(key=api_key, secret=api_secret)
+```
+
+For production, you can specify the `NEXMO_API_KEY` and `NEXMO_API_SECRET`
+environment variables instead of specifying the key and secret explicitly.
+
+For newer endpoints that support JWT authentication such as the Voice API,
+you can also specify the `application_id` and `private_key` arguments:
+
+```python
+client = nexmo.Client(application_id=application_id, private_key=private_key)
+```
+
+To check signatures for incoming webhook requests, you'll also need
+to specify the `signature_secret` argument (or the `NEXMO_SIGNATURE_SECRET`
+environment variable).
+
+## SMS API
+
+### SMS Class
+
+#### Creating an instance of the SMS class
+
+To create an instance of the SMS class follow these steps:
+
+- Import the class
+
+```python
+#Option 1
+from nexmo import Sms
+
+#Option 2
+from nexmo.sms import Sms
+
+#Option 3
+import nexmo #then you can use nexmo.Sms() to create an instance
+```
+
+- Create an instance
+
+```python
+#Option 1 - pass key and secret to the constructor
+sms = Sms(key=NEXMO_API_KEY, secret=NEXMO_API_SECRET)
+
+#Option 2 - Create a client instance and then pass the client to the Sms instance
+client = Client(key=NEXMO_API_KEY, secret=NEXMO_API_SECRET)
+sms = Sms(client)
+```
+
+### Send an SMS
+
+```python
+from nexmo import Sms
+sms = Sms(key=NEXMO_API_KEY, secret=NEXMO_API_SECRET)
+sms.send_message({
+ "from": NEXMO_BRAND_NAME,
+ "to": TO_NUMBER,
+ "text": "A text message sent using the Nexmo SMS API",
+})
+```
+
+### Send SMS with unicode
+
+```python
+sms.send_message({
+ 'from': NEXMO_BRAND_NAME,
+ 'to': TO_NUMBER,
+ 'text': 'こんにちは世界',
+ 'type': 'unicode',
+})
+```
+
+### Submit SMS Conversion
+
+```python
+from nexmo import Client, Sms
+client = Client(key=NEXMO_API_KEY, secret=NEXMO_SECRET)
+sms = Sms(client)
+response = sms.send_message({
+ 'from': NEXMO_BRAND_NAME,
+ 'to': TO_NUMBER,
+ 'text': 'Hi from Vonage'
+})
+sms.submit_sms_conversion(response['message-id'])
+```
+
+## Voice API
+
+### Make a call
+
+```python
+from nexmo import Client, Voice
+client = Client(application_id=APPLICATION_ID, private_key=PRIVATE_KEY)
+voice = Voice(client)
+voice.create_all({
+ 'to': [{'type': 'phone', 'number': '14843331234'}],
+ 'from': {'type': 'phone', 'number': '14843335555'},
+ 'answer_url': ['https://example.com/answer']
+})
+```
+
+### Retrieve a list of calls
+
+```python
+from nexmo import Client, Voice
+client = Client(application_id=APPLICATION_ID, private_key=PRIVATE_KEY)
+voice = Voice(client)
+voice.get_calls()
+```
+
+### Retrieve a single call
+
+```python
+from nexmo import Client, Voice
+client = Client(application_id=APPLICATION_ID, private_key=PRIVATE_KEY)
+voice = Voice(client)
+voice.get_call(uuid)
+```
+
+### Update a call
+
+```python
+from nexmo import Client, Voice
+client = Client(application_id=APPLICATION_ID, private_key=PRIVATE_KEY)
+voice = Voice(client)
+response = voice.create_all({
+ 'to': [{'type': 'phone', 'number': '14843331234'}],
+ 'from': {'type': 'phone', 'number': '14843335555'},
+ 'answer_url': ['https://example.com/answer']
+})
+voice.update_call(response['uuid'], action='hangup')
+```
+
+### Stream audio to a call
+
+```python
+from nexmo import Client, Voice
+client = Client(application_id=APPLICATION_ID, private_key=PRIVATE_KEY)
+voice = Voice(client)
+stream_url = 'https://nexmo-community.github.io/ncco-examples/assets/voice_api_audio_streaming.mp3'
+response = voice.create_call({
+ 'to': [{'type': 'phone', 'number': '14843331234'}],
+ 'from': {'type': 'phone', 'number': '14843335555'},
+ 'answer_url': ['https://example.com/answer']
+})
+voice.send_audio(response['uuid'],stream_url=[stream_url])
+```
+
+### Stop streaming audio to a call
+
+```python
+from nexmo import Client, Voice
+client = Client(application_id='0d4884d1-eae8-4f18-a46a-6fb14d5fdaa6', private_key='./private.key')
+voice = Voice(client)
+stream_url = 'https://nexmo-community.github.io/ncco-examples/assets/voice_api_audio_streaming.mp3'
+response = voice.create_call({
+ 'to': [{'type': 'phone', 'number': '14843331234'}],
+ 'from': {'type': 'phone', 'number': '14843335555'},
+ 'answer_url': ['https://example.com/answer']
+})
+voice.send_audio(response['uuid'],stream_url=[stream_url])
+voice.stop_audio(response['uuid'])
+```
+
+### Send a synthesized speech message to a call
+
+```python
+from nexmo import Client, Voice
+client = Client(application_id=APPLICATION_ID, private_key=PRIVATE_KEY)
+voice = Voice(client)
+response = voice.create_call({
+ 'to': [{'type': 'phone', 'number': '14843331234'}],
+ 'from': {'type': 'phone', 'number': '14843335555'},
+ 'answer_url': ['https://example.com/answer']
+})
+voice.send_speech(response['uuid'], text='Hello from nexmo')
+```
+
+### Stop sending a synthesized speech message to a call
+
+```python
+>>> from nexmo import Client, Voice
+>>> client = Client(application_id=APPLICATION_ID, private_key=APPLICATION_ID)
+>>> voice = Voice(client)
+>>> response = voice.create_call({
+ 'to': [{'type': 'phone', 'number': '14843331234'}],
+ 'from': {'type': 'phone', 'number': '14843335555'},
+ 'answer_url': ['https://example.com/answer']
+})
+>>> voice.send_speech(response['uuid'], text='Hello from nexmo')
+>>> voice.stop_speech(response['uuid'])
+```
+
+### Send DTMF tones to a call
+
+```python
+from nexmo import Client, Voice
+client = Client(application_id=APPLICATION_ID, private_key=PRIVATE_KEY)
+voice = Voice(client)
+response = voice.create_call({
+ 'to': [{'type': 'phone', 'number': '14843331234'}],
+ 'from': {'type': 'phone', 'number': '14843335555'},
+ 'answer_url': ['https://example.com/answer']
+})
+voice.send_dtmf(response['uuid'], digits='1234')
+```
+
+### Get recording
+
+```python
+response = client.get_recording(RECORDING_URL)
+```
+
+## Verify API
+
+### Verify Class
+
+#### Creating an instance of the class
+
+To create an instance of the Verify class, Just follow the next steps:
+​
+
+- **Import the class from module** (3 different ways)
+
+```python
+#First way
+from nexmo import Verify
+​
+#Second way
+from nexmo.verify import Verify
+​
+#Third valid way
+import nexmo #then you can use nexmo.Verify() to create an instance
+```
+
+- **Create the instance**
+ ​
+
+```python
+#First way - pass key and secret to the constructor
+verify = Verify(key=NEXMO_API_KEY, secret=NEXMO_API_SECRET)
+​
+#Second way - Create a client instance and then pass the client to the Verify contructor
+client = Client(key=NEXMO_API_KEY, secret=NEXMO_API_SECRET)
+verify = Verify(client)
+```
+
+### Search for a Verification request
+
+```python
+client = Client(key='API_KEY', secret='API_SECRET')
+
+verify = Verify(client)
+response = verify.search('69e2626cbc23451fbbc02f627a959677')
+
+if response is not None:
+ print(response['status'])
+```
+
+### Send verification code
+
+```python
+client = Client(key='API_KEY', secret='API_SECRET')
+
+verify = Verify(client)
+response = verify.request(number=RECIPIENT_NUMBER, brand='AcmeInc')
+
+if response["status"] == "0":
+ print("Started verification request_id is %s" % (response["request_id"]))
+else:
+ print("Error: %s" % response["error_text"])
+```
+
+### Send verification code with workflow
+
+```python
+client = Client(key='API_KEY', secret='API_SECRET')
+
+verify = Verify(client)
+response = verify.request(number=RECIPIENT_NUMBER, brand='AcmeInc', workflow_id=1)
+
+if response["status"] == "0":
+ print("Started verification request_id is %s" % (response["request_id"]))
+else:
+ print("Error: %s" % response["error_text"])
+```
+
+### Check verification code
+
+```python
+client = Client(key='API_KEY', secret='API_SECRET')
+
+verify = Verify(client)
+response = verify.check(REQUEST_ID, code=CODE)
+
+if response["status"] == "0":
+ print("Verification successful, event_id is %s" % (response["event_id"]))
+else:
+ print("Error: %s" % response["error_text"])
+```
+
+### Cancel Verification Request
+
+```python
+client = Client(key='API_KEY', secret='API_SECRET')
+
+verify = Verify(client)
+response = verify.cancel(REQUEST_ID)
+
+if response["status"] == "0":
+ print("Cancellation successful")
+else:
+ print("Error: %s" % response["error_text"])
+```
+
+### Trigger next verification proccess
+
+```python
+client = Client(key='API_KEY', secret='API_SECRET')
+
+verify = Verify(client)
+response = verify.trigger_next_event(REQUEST_ID)
+
+if response["status"] == "0":
+ print("Next verification stage triggered")
+else:
+ print("Error: %s" % response["error_text"])
+```
+
+### Send payment authentication code
+
+```python
+client = Client(key='API_KEY', secret='API_SECRET')
+
+verify = Verify(client)
+response = verify.psd2(number=RECIPIENT_NUMBER, payee=PAYEE, amount=AMOUNT)
+
+if response["status"] == "0":
+ print("Started PSD2 verification request_id is %s" % (response["request_id"]))
+else:
+ print("Error: %s" % response["error_text"])
+```
+
+### Send payment authentication code with workflow
+
+```python
+client = Client(key='API_KEY', secret='API_SECRET')
+
+verify = Verify(client)
+verify.psd2(number=RECIPIENT_NUMBER, payee=PAYEE, amount=AMOUNT, workflow_id: WORKFLOW_ID)
+
+if response["status"] == "0":
+ print("Started PSD2 verification request_id is %s" % (response["request_id"]))
+else:
+ print("Error: %s" % response["error_text"])
+```
+

+## Managing Secrets
+
+An API is provided to allow you to rotate your API secrets. You can create a new secret (up to a maximum of two secrets) and delete the existing one once all applications have been updated.
+
+### List Secrets
+
+```python
+secrets = client.list_secrets(API_KEY)
+```
+
+### Create A New Secret
+
+Create a new secret (the created dates will help you know which is which):
+
+```python
+client.create_secret(API_KEY, 'awes0meNewSekret!!;');
+```
+
+### Delete A Secret
+
+Delete the old secret (any application still using these credentials will stop working):
+
+```python
+client.delete_secret(API_KEY, 'my-secret-id')
+```
+

+## Validate webhook signatures
+
+```python
+client = nexmo.Client(signature_secret='secret')
+
+if client.check_signature(request.query):
+ # valid signature
+else:
+ # invalid signature
+```
+
+Docs: [https://developer.nexmo.com/concepts/guides/signing-messages](https://developer.nexmo.com/concepts/guides/signing-messages?utm_source=DEV_REL&utm_medium=github&utm_campaign=python-client-library)
+
+Note: you'll need to contact support@nexmo.com to enable message signing on
+your account before you can validate webhook signatures.
+
+## JWT parameters
+
+By default, the library generates short-lived tokens for JWT authentication.
+
+Use the auth method to specify parameters for a longer life token or to
+specify a different token identifier:
+
+```python
+client.auth(nbf=nbf, exp=exp, jti=jti)
+```
+
+## Overriding API Attributes
+
+In order to rewrite/get the value of variables used across all the Nexmo classes Python uses `Call by Object Reference` that allows you to create a single client for Sms/Voice Classes. This means that if you make a change on a client instance this will be available for the Sms class.
+
+An example using setters/getters with `Object references`:
+
+```python
+from nexmo import Client, Sms
+
+#Defines the client
+client = Client(key='YOUR_API_KEY', secret='YOUR_API_SECRET')
+print(client.host()) # using getter for host -- value returned: rest.nexmo.com
+
+#Define the sms instance
+sms = Sms(client)
+
+#Change the value in client
+client.host('mio.nexmo.com') #Change host to mio.nexmo.com - this change will be available for sms
+
+```
+
+### Overriding API Host / Host Attributes
+
+These attributes are private in the client class and the only way to access them is using the getters/setters we provide.
+
+```python
+from nexmo import Client
+
+client = Client(key='YOUR_API_KEY', secret='YOUR_API_SECRET')
+print(client.host()) # return rest.nexmo.com
+client.host('mio.nexmo.com') # rewrites the host value to mio.nexmo.com
+print(client.api_host()) # returns api.nexmo.com
+client.api_host('myapi.nexmo.com') # rewrite the value of api_host
+```
+
